Reasons to book a car rental in and around Stoke

Renting a car in Stoke provides the freedom and flexibility to explore the area at your own pace. With a rental car, you can easily manage your luggage and create flexible travel plans, making it particularly appealing for families and those looking for outdoor experiences. You can visit nearby attractions like Hoe Park, located just 1 mile from Stoke, perfect for a family outing or a leisurely walk. If you’re in the mood for a beach day, Whitsand Bay Beach is only 6 miles away, offering a beautiful seaside experience. For a touch of history, the Mayflower Steps are a mere 2 miles from Stoke, allowing you to immerse yourself in local culture.

A rental car also opens up convenient access to nearby cities. Plymouth features additional attractions, while Torpoint, just 2 miles away, offers more beach options and sites like Polhawn Fort. Saltash, located 3 miles from Stoke, is home to Cotehele House and Gardens. Having a car means you can explore these destinations without the constraints of public transport, making your visit to Stoke and its surroundings truly enjoyable.

10 tips to save on your car rental in and around Stoke

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by selecting vehicle types and features. Whether you're looking for an SUV for added space, a convertible for summer enjoyment, or an economy car for budget-friendly travel, utilize the filters on Expedia to discover the perfect match for your needs.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ental prices can vary based on demand, so it's wise to reserve your car well ahead of your trip. By booking in advance, you're likely to lock in lower rates and enjoy a wider selection, especially during peak travel se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Compact cars are typically more affordable to rent and easier to maneuver in crowded areas. Mid-size vehicles strike a good balance between cost,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under the age of 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ily fees, and certain vehicle categories—such as SUVs or premium models—might not be available. This can also apply to renters over the age of 70. Always verify the age restrictions before making a reservation.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rental agreements require a full-to-full fuel policy, which means you must return the car with a full tank to avoid additional charges. This is usually the most economical choice. Other options may include full-to-empty or prepaid fueling, which can also work, but ensure you return the vehicle empty in that case.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but the added convenience may justify the extra cost.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ies only acc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Rental car ins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and provides peace of mind in case something unforeseen occurs during your trip. It's easy to add rental insurance when you book through Expedia.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you're planning extended road trips, look for rental options that offer unlimited mileage to prevent incurring extra char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is necessary to rent a car.

Best time to rent a car in and around Stoke

The best value period to rent a car in and around Stoke is February, when both prices and demand are at their lowest. Following that, November offers slightly lower prices with low demand, making it another favorable time. March and April see a bit of a rise in prices and average demand, while July stands out as the most expensive month due to high demand. June through August also experience high demand, further driving up rental costs during those months.
